Overview

Postcode GL54 2RN is located in a rural town, within the Bourton Village ward of Cotswold in the South West region, and forms part of the Bourton-on-the-Water & Vale area. It has very low deprivation and average crime levels, with around 49.7 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 42% below the South West average of 85 per 1,000. The average income per household in Bourton-on-the-Water & Vale is £60,434 per year. The nearest station is Kingham, about 5.7 miles away. There are 1 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area.
